html怎么连接数据库php
-
要在HTML中连接数据库,通常需要使用服务器端的脚本语言来实现。PHP是一种常用的服务器端脚本语言,可以与HTML结合使用。
以下是通过PHP连接数据库的基本步骤:
1. 在HTML页面中添加一个表单,用于用户输入相关信息,例如用户名和密码。
2. 创建一个PHP文件,用于处理HTML表单的数据和连接数据库。
3. 在PHP文件中使用以下代码连接数据库:
“`php
connect_error) {
die(“连接数据库失败: ” . $conn->connect_error);
}// 接下来可以执行数据库操作,例如查询、插入或更新数据
// …// 最后记得关闭数据库连接
$conn->close();
?>
“`
请将以上代码中的”数据库服务器名称”、”数据库用户名”、”数据库密码”和”数据库名称”替换为实际的数据库信息。4. 在PHP中可以使用SQL语句执行数据库操作,例如查询数据并返回结果到HTML页面。
5. 在PHP文件中处理数据库操作完成后,将结果返回给HTML页面,可以使用echo语句将结果输出到页面上。
这样,当用户在HTML表单中提交数据时,PHP将接收到数据并连接到数据库,执行相关操作,然后将结果返回给HTML页面。
2年前 -
连接数据库是在服务器端进行的操作,所以需要使用PHP来连接数据库。下面是使用PHP连接HTML的步骤:
1. 安装和配置PHP:首先确保已经安装了PHP,并且在服务器上进行了正确的配置。
2. 创建数据库:在连接数据库之前,需要创建一个数据库。可以使用MySQL或其他关系型数据库管理系统来创建数据库。
3. 创建数据库连接:在PHP中,可以使用mysqli或PDO来连接数据库。以下是使用mysqli连接数据库的示例代码: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
} else {
echo “连接成功”;
}// 关闭数据库连接
$conn->close();
?>
“`4. 执行数据库查询:一旦成功连接到数据库,就可以执行各种数据库查询操作,例如插入、更新和选择数据。
以下是一个使用mysqli执行数据库查询的示例代码:
“`php
connect_error) {
die(“连接失败: ” . $conn->connect_error);
} else {
echo “连接成功”;
}// 执行查询语句
$sql = “SELECT * FROM table_name”;
$result = $conn->query($sql);// 处理查询结果
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o “字段1: ” . $row[“column1″]. ” – 字段2: ” . $row[“column2”]. “
“;
}
} else {
echo “0 结果”;
}// 关闭数据库连接
$conn->close();
?>
“`5. 将查询结果显示在HTML页面上:可以使用PHP将查询结果显示在HTML页面上。将查询结果传递给HTML模板,并使用PHP在数据位置插入结果。
6. 处理用户输入:在连接数据库之前,通常需要对用户输入进行验证和过滤,以防止SQL注入和其他安全问题。
以上是通过PHP来连接HTML页面的数据库的步骤。但是需要注意的是,HTML是用来构建网页内容的标记语言,而不是用来连接数据库的。连接数据库是在服务器端进行的,而不是在客户端的HTML页面中。
2年前 -
HTML是一种用于创建网页结构和布局的标记语言,它本身并不支持连接数据库。要连接数据库,我们需要使用一种服务器端的编程语言,例如PHP。
在PHP中,可以使用一些数据库扩展来连接和操作数据库。最常用的数据库扩展是MySQLi和PDO。下面是使用这两个扩展连接数据库的操作流程。
1. 安装和配置数据库:
首先,我们需要安装和配置一个数据库服务器,例如MySQL。可以通过官方网站下载安装程序,并按照安装向导进行操作。安装完成后,需要创建一个数据库,并为其设置用户名和密码。2. 连接数据库:
在PHP中,我们可以使用以下代码来连接数据库:
“`php
“`
需要将上述代码中的”your_username”、”your_password”和”your_database”替换为实际的数据库用户名、密码和数据库名。3. 执行查询操作:
连接数据库后,我们可以通过执行SQL查询来操作数据库。以下是一个使用MySQLi扩展执行查询的示例:
“`php
query($sql);if ($result->num_rows > 0) {
// 输出数据
while($row = $result->fetch_assoc()) {
echo “ID: ” . $row[“id”]. ” – Name: ” . $row[“name”]. “
“;
}
} else {
echo “0 results”;
}
?>
“`
在上述代码中,”your_table”应该替换为实际的数据库表名。执行查询后,我们可以使用循环遍历$result对象中的数据,并对其进行操作。4. 关闭数据库连接:
在操作完成后,我们应该关闭数据库连接,释放资源。以下是关闭数据库连接的示例代码:
“`php
close();// 使用PDO扩展关闭连接
$conn = null;
?>
“`
在上述代码中,我们使用$conn->close()关闭MySQLi扩展的连接,使用$conn = null关闭PDO扩展的连接。以上就是使用PHP连接数据库的基本步骤。通过这些操作,我们可以在网页中使用HTML和PHP来获取和展示数据库中的数据。
2年前